ilib_build cannot build a library with more than 999 function entries in Scilab 6
Reported by Simon MARCHETTO
Originally assigned to Simon MARCHETTO
HOW TO REPRODUCE THE BUG:
-------------------------
funcs = ["foo" + string(1:1000)', "sci_foo" + string(1:1000)'];
ilib_build("foo", funcs, "foo.c", []);
ERROR LOG:
----------
at line 36 of function ilib_build ( H:\Apps\Scilab-6.0.0\modules\dynamic_link\macros\ilib_build.sci line 49 )
ilib_build: Wrong size for input argument #2: A matrix of strings < 999 expected.
OTHER INFORMATION:
------------------
The maximum of 999 entries is a limitation of Scilab 5, and disappears in Scilab 6.
The check in ilib_build responsible of this error must be removed.